- Real Life Writes the Plot: His battle with the bottle was written into a storyline on Nitro. Hall's former tag team partner and friend Kevin Nash participated in this storyline, greeting Hall in the ring and offering him another "shot" — a boot to the chin, that is. The storyline was mainly an excuse for Hall to go on sabbatical, while allowing Nash to add another notch to his (wrestling) belt.

- Throw It In!: According to Scott, the gimmick of Razor Ramon seems to have started out like this. When he first met Vince McMahon, he tried to show he could play a character by doing an impression of Tony Montana. Vince thought it was an original concept, and said it could work for him with a few tweaks.
- What Could Have Been: In late 1995, he was reportedly in talks to split to All Japan Pro Wrestling for a full-time deal after his WWF contract went up. Needless to say, the Monday Night wars may have gone into an entirely different direction if that happened.
